Output 908a828867bbebb5fe1625b2883766ce0b19ff6c6914c78578094aba1a73dd61:10

value
53824089
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1b142ef21efad3fd7e33c533d1b2efefd78cbbd9 OP_EQUALVERIFY OP_CHECKSIG
address
LMh8gkwWRsJE6jrtBgrp7X19emJBiD4Kc4
transaction
908a828867bbebb5fe1625b2883766ce0b19ff6c6914c78578094aba1a73dd61
spent
true